Why a hypothyroidism diet is different for women

In iodine-sufficient countries, roughly 90% of hypothyroidism is autoimmune — a condition called Hashimoto's thyroiditis, where your immune system slowly destroys thyroid tissue (JAMA 2025). It is overwhelmingly a women's disease, striking women up to eight to ten times more often than men, and it tends to surface during hormonal pivot points: postpartum, perimenopause, after a period of intense stress.

That matters enormously for your diet. If the root issue were simply "not enough thyroid fuel," you could just eat more iodine and be done. But when the problem is an over-activated immune system, the goal of food shifts. You want to do two things at once:

1. Supply the nutrients your thyroid physically needs to build and activate hormone — selenium, zinc, iron, tyrosine, and adequate iodine.

2. Lower the inflammatory and immune signals that keep the autoimmune attack burning — by stabilizing blood sugar, healing the gut lining, and removing personal trigger foods.

Your thyroid produces mostly T4, a storage hormone that is relatively inactive. Your body then has to convert T4 into T3, the active form that actually speeds up your metabolism in every cell. That conversion happens largely in your liver and gut, and it depends on specific minerals — which is exactly why a nutrient-poor, inflamed, ultra-processed diet leaves you feeling hypothyroid even when you're taking medication. You're making the hormone but failing to activate it.

A whole-food, anti-inflammatory pattern that pointedly includes the thyroid's cofactor nutrients addresses both layers. That's the plan. Here's how to build it, step by step.

1. Build every meal around protein and tyrosine

Thyroid hormone is literally built from an amino acid called tyrosine, with iodine atoms attached. No tyrosine, no T4. While outright tyrosine deficiency is rare, women on low-protein, calorie-restricted diets — common among those fighting hypothyroid weight gain — often run short on the building blocks.

Protein also blunts the blood-sugar roller coaster that drives inflammation and cortisol spikes, both of which suppress T4-to-T3 conversion. When your blood sugar crashes, your body releases cortisol to rescue it — and elevated cortisol actively diverts T4 down the inactive "reverse T3" pathway instead of into usable T3. So every blood-sugar dip is, quietly, a small hit to your active thyroid hormone. Protein is your simplest lever against that cascade.

Aim for 25–35 grams of protein per meal: eggs, fish, poultry, Greek yogurt, lentils, and tofu are all rich in tyrosine. A protein-forward breakfast in particular stabilizes your whole day's energy and curbs the afternoon crash that hypothyroid women know too well. A useful mental template: picture your plate as a palm-sized protein, half a plate of non-starchy vegetables, and a fist of quality carbohydrate. If you do nothing else structurally, front-loading protein at breakfast — say, two or three eggs instead of toast and jam — changes the trajectory of your entire day's hormones.

2. Get selenium — the single most studied thyroid nutrient

If you do one targeted thing, do this. Selenium is the cofactor for the enzymes (deiodinases) that convert storage T4 into active T3, and for glutathione peroxidase, which protects the thyroid from the oxidative damage it generates while making hormone.

In Hashimoto's specifically, selenium supplementation has been shown in a systematic review and meta-analysis of randomized clinical trials to reduce thyroid peroxidase (TPO) antibodies, particularly in people who were selenium-deficient to begin with (Thyroid 2024). Lower antibodies signal a calmer immune attack.

You don't need a megadose. One to two Brazil nuts per day delivers roughly 100–200 mcg of selenium — close to the studied range. Sardines, tuna, eggs, and sunflower seeds are also solid sources. A word of caution: selenium has a relatively narrow safe window, so don't stack a high-dose supplement on top of a handful of Brazil nuts. Chronic intakes well above 400 mcg per day can cause selenium toxicity, with hair loss, brittle nails, and a garlic-like breath odor — ironically mimicking some hypothyroid symptoms. More is not better here; consistency at the right dose is what matters. Because Brazil nuts vary widely in selenium content depending on where they're grown, treating one to two nuts as roughly "a serving" rather than chasing an exact microgram target is the sane, sustainable approach.

3. Respect iodine — but never assume more is better

Iodine is the atom that gets bolted onto tyrosine to make thyroid hormone, so adequate intake is non-negotiable. But here is the trap that sends countless women down the wrong path: in a country with iodized salt and dairy, true iodine deficiency is uncommon, and your hypothyroidism is far more likely autoimmune.

In that setting, excess iodine can actually worsen autoimmune thyroiditis, increasing thyroid inflammation and antibody levels (Nutrients 2026). The thyroid sits in a Goldilocks zone — too little iodine and you can't make hormone, too much and you pour fuel on the autoimmune fire.

The practical takeaway: get adequate iodine from a normal diet — seafood, dairy, eggs, and iodized salt — and steer clear of high-dose iodine pills and daily kelp or seaweed supplements unless a clinician is specifically guiding you based on tested iodine status. The "thyroid support" supplements loaded with kelp are, for many Hashimoto's women, exactly the wrong move.

4. Cover your zinc, iron, and vitamin A

Three more cofactors quietly gate your thyroid function:

  • Zinc is required for converting T4 to T3 and for the receptors that let cells respond to thyroid hormone. Oysters, beef, pumpkin seeds, and chickpeas deliver it.
  • Iron is essential for thyroid peroxidase, the enzyme that makes hormone in the first place. Hypothyroid women are frequently iron-deficient — and low iron blunts both hormone production and conversion. Heavy menstrual bleeding (itself common with thyroid disease) makes this worse, creating a vicious loop. Red meat, lentils, and dark leafy greens (paired with vitamin C for absorption) help.
  • Vitamin A supports the thyroid hormone receptor's ability to do its job. Liver, eggs, and orange-fleshed vegetables (which supply beta-carotene) cover it.

This is why a varied, colorful, whole-food diet outperforms any single "thyroid superfood." You're filling multiple cofactor gaps at once. A particularly common and overlooked pattern in hypothyroid women is the iron–thyroid trap: low thyroid function reduces stomach acid, which impairs iron absorption, while heavy thyroid-driven periods drain iron stores — so the deficiency that worsens your thyroid is itself partly caused by your thyroid. Breaking that loop often means addressing ferritin (not just hemoglobin) directly, since ferritin can be low long before standard anemia shows up on a basic blood count.

5. Fix your vitamin D — it's an immune regulator

Vitamin D is less about making thyroid hormone and more about calming the immune system that attacks it. Low vitamin D status is consistently associated with autoimmune thyroid disease, and the vitamin acts as an immunomodulator that helps keep self-attacking immune cells in check (Nutrients 2026).

Most women with Hashimoto's, especially in northern climates with long winters, run low. Fatty fish, egg yolks, and sensible sun exposure help, but food alone rarely closes a real deficiency — this is one nutrient genuinely worth testing and, if low, repleting under guidance toward a healthy serum level.

6. Consider a structured gluten-free trial

This is the most debated piece, so let's be precise. There is a well-documented overlap between celiac disease and Hashimoto's — they share genetic and immune machinery. But even in non-celiac women, a gluten-free diet may modestly lower thyroid antibodies: a systematic review and meta-analysis found that a gluten-free diet in non-celiac Hashimoto's was associated with reductions in thyroid antibody levels, though the authors rightly note the evidence base is still small and more research is needed (Nutrients 2025).

The honest framing: gluten is not universally the enemy, but a meaningful subset of women — particularly those with bloating, reflux, or other gut symptoms — feel noticeably better off it. The smart move is a structured 6–12 week trial: go genuinely gluten-free, track your energy, digestion, and (if possible) re-check antibodies, then decide based on your own data rather than internet dogma. 7. Stabilize blood sugar and slash ultra-processed foods

Every blood-sugar spike triggers an insulin surge, and chronically high insulin drives inflammation that suppresses T4-to-T3 conversion and disrupts immune balance. Ultra-processed foods — refined flour, added sugars, industrial fried foods — are the engine of that cycle.

You don't need a rigid low-carb protocol. You need quality carbohydrates eaten with protein, fat, and fiber so glucose enters your bloodstream gently. Swap the breakfast pastry for eggs and berries. Build lunch from a protein, a pile of vegetables, and a fist-sized serving of an intact whole grain or starchy root. The metabolic calm you create downstream is exactly the environment in which your thyroid hormone works best.

8. Feed your gut — the conversion factory

Roughly 20% of your T4-to-T3 conversion happens in your gut, mediated by a healthy microbiome. A disrupted, inflamed gut both reduces hormone activation and is increasingly implicated in fueling autoimmunity in the first place.

Feed it deliberately: fermented foods (yogurt, kefir, sauerkraut, kimchi) for live cultures, and a wide range of plant fibers — cooked vegetables, legumes, oats, flax — for the prebiotic fuel your beneficial bacteria need. A diverse fiber intake is one of the most underrated thyroid interventions because it works at the conversion step that medication alone can't reach.

There's a second reason gut health matters specifically in autoimmune hypothyroidism: a compromised intestinal barrier ("leaky gut") lets partially digested proteins and bacterial fragments slip into circulation, keeping the immune system in a state of low-grade alarm. For an immune system already primed to attack thyroid tissue, that constant background provocation is the opposite of what you want. This is the through-line connecting blood sugar, fiber, fermented foods, and even the gluten question — they all converge on calming an over-stimulated immune system at the gut, which is where roughly 70% of your immune cells live.

9. Cook your cruciferous vegetables (and stop fearing them)

You've probably read that broccoli, kale, and cabbage are "goitrogens" that harm the thyroid. The truth is far less dramatic. These vegetables contain compounds that can mildly interfere with iodine uptake, but only in genuinely large raw quantities — think daily liters of raw kale juice — and the effect is largely neutralized by cooking, which deactivates the relevant enzyme.

For the overwhelming majority of women, cruciferous vegetables are powerful allies: they're loaded with fiber, antioxidants, and compounds that support healthy estrogen metabolism — itself relevant to the hormonal balance underlying thyroid health. Eat them, ideally cooked, in normal portions, without anxiety. The fiber and micronutrients far outweigh any theoretical iodine concern in someone with adequate iodine intake.

How to actually eat for your thyroid (most people do it wrong)

Here's where the standard advice falls apart. Most "hypothyroidism diets" hand you a list of foods and stop there. But the way you eat — the structure, the timing, the testing behind it — matters as much as the list.

Test before you supplement. Before adding iodine, selenium, or anything else, know your numbers: a full thyroid panel (TSH, free T4, free T3, and TPO/Tg antibodies), plus ferritin, vitamin D, zinc, and selenium where possible. Megadosing nutrients you already have enough of — iodine especially — can backfire and worsen autoimmunity. The root-cause approach is to measure the gap, then fill it, not to throw supplements at a problem you haven't characterized.

Separate your levothyroxine from food and minerals. If you take thyroid medication, take it on an empty stomach and wait 30–60 minutes before eating. Critically, separate it by at least four hours from calcium, iron, and high-fiber meals, all of which can block its absorption. Plenty of women blame their diet for poor results when the real issue is a coffee-and-supplement breakfast sabotaging their dose.

Run trials, not lifelong rules. Instead of permanently banishing food groups out of fear, run defined experiments. A 6–12 week gluten-free trial. A two-week added-sugar reset. Track symptoms and, when you can, labs. Keep what demonstrably helps you, and release the rest. Your thyroid responds to your individual biology, not to a generic protocol. The women who get stuck are usually those who either change ten things at once (and learn nothing about what worked) or change nothing for fear of doing it wrong. A trial gives you a clean answer: one variable, a defined window, a tracked outcome.

This is the functional-medicine wedge: hypothyroidism is rarely one broken part. It's a network — immune activity, nutrient status, gut health, blood sugar, and stress hormones all interacting. Eating to support the whole network, guided by your actual labs, is what separates women who slowly feel human again from those who chase symptoms in circles.

Frequently Asked Questions

What is the best diet plan for hypothyroidism?
There is no one-size-fits-all hypothyroidism diet, but the most effective pattern is an anti-inflammatory, whole-food diet that supplies the nutrients your thyroid depends on — selenium, zinc, iron, tyrosine and adequate iodine — while minimizing ultra-processed foods, excess sugar, and (for many women with Hashimoto's) gluten. Because most hypothyroidism in women is autoimmune, the diet should aim to calm immune activity and repair the gut, not simply cut calories.
What foods should I avoid with hypothyroidism?
Prioritize cutting ultra-processed foods, excess added sugar, and trans/industrial seed-oil-heavy fried foods, which fuel inflammation. Many women with Hashimoto's feel better off gluten. Avoid megadose iodine supplements and large daily amounts of kelp or seaweed, since excess iodine can worsen autoimmune thyroiditis. Raw cruciferous vegetables in extreme quantities can mildly affect iodine uptake, but normal cooked portions are healthful and fine for most people.
Can a hypothyroidism diet help me lose weight?
Diet can help, but the stubborn weight gain in hypothyroidism is driven largely by a slowed metabolic rate and fluid retention, so weight loss is usually slower than expected until thyroid hormone levels are optimized. A protein-forward, blood-sugar-stabilizing, anti-inflammatory pattern supports a healthier metabolism, but for elevated TSH, weight changes are most reliable once medication and nutrient status are also addressed.
Should I take iodine for an underactive thyroid?
Not without testing. In iodine-replete countries, most hypothyroidism is autoimmune (Hashimoto's), not iodine deficiency — and excess iodine can actually worsen autoimmune thyroiditis. Adequate iodine from a normal diet (seafood, dairy, iodized salt, eggs) is the goal; high-dose iodine or kelp supplements should only be considered with a clinician guiding you based on your iodine status.
Does going gluten-free help Hashimoto's hypothyroidism?
It may help a subset of women, especially those with gut symptoms or celiac/gluten sensitivity. Several small studies suggest a gluten-free diet can modestly lower thyroid antibodies in non-celiac Hashimoto's, though the evidence is still limited. A structured 6–12 week trial, tracking symptoms and antibodies, is a reasonable way to learn whether you personally respond.
